Summary
Relative to the administration of glucagon injections for children in schools.

History
| Date | Chamber | Action |
|---|---|---|
| 2015-05-08 | Senate | Signed by the Governor on 05/05/2015; Chapter 0020; Effective 07/04/2015 |
| 2015-04-29 | Senate | Enrolled (In recess 4/9/2015); Senate Journal 12 |
| 2015-04-29 | House | Enrolled; House Journal 36, PG. 1597 |
| 2015-04-15 | House | Ought to Pass: Motion Adopted Voice Vote; House Journal 34, PG. 1534 |
| 2015-04-08 | House | Committee Report: Ought to Pass for Apr 15 (Vote 21-0; Consent Calendar); House Calendar 29, PG. 1301 |
| 2015-03-24 | House | Executive Session: 3/31/2015 11:15 Amendment Legislative Office Building 207 |
| 2015-03-17 | House | Public Hearing: 3/24/2015 9:50 Amendment Legislative Office Building 207 |
| 2015-03-04 | House | Introduced and Referred to Education; House Journal 22, PG. 629 |
| 2015-02-12 | Senate | Ought to Pass: Motion Adopted, Voice Vote; OT3rdg; Senate Journal 5 |
| 2015-02-04 | Senate | Committee Report: Ought to Pass, 2/12/15; Vote 5-0; Consent Calendar; Senate Calendar 9 |
| 2015-01-14 | Senate | Hearing: 1/20/15, Room 103, Legislative Office Building, 9:00 a.m.; Senate Calendar 6 |
| 2015-01-08 | Senate | Introduced and Referred to Education; Senate Journal 4 |
